Extremely obscure, low-low budget cheapie with an amusing history.

It started out as "Terror at Halfway", but it only got halfway finished. Producer Herschell Gordon Lewis bought the half-movie, filmed the other half (more-or-less), and recorded a narration to make the plot less confusing.

The star is Henry Height, "the tallest man in the world", as an astronaut who suffers the mutating effects of cosmic rays and returns to Earth as (what else?) a giant.



"Monster A Go-Go" was given a very limited release, playing to less than half the country, with good reason, since it is a complete waste of time.

Don't bother.

Lewis shared directing chores with Bill Rebane.
